Key Factors Contributing to China's 30% Global Wine Opener Market Share

You know, China really has a solid grip on the global wine opener market, holding an impressive 30% share. And honestly, there are a few key reasons behind its success that really highlight the country's manufacturing strengths. First off, they've got some pretty advanced production technologies in play here. A report from 2022 by the China National Light Industry Council pointed out that with all the automation and precision engineering being used in their factories, production efficiency and product quality have shot up. This tech advantage allows Chinese manufacturers to tap into that international demand, offering a whole bunch of innovative and budget-friendly wine opener options.

And let’s not forget about China's strong supply chain and logistics networks – they're a big part of the puzzle too! The 2022 Global Wine Industry Report mentioned that the country’s top-notch infrastructure really helps with quick distribution and keeps shipping costs down. That means lower operational expenses for the manufacturers and, in turn, retailers around the world get their high-quality products without delay. Plus, by sourcing raw materials locally, they manage to slash production costs even further. This all gives Chinese wine opener makers a leg up on pricing in the global market, helping them stay on top of their game.

Challenges Faced by China's Wine Opener Export Market and Solutions

You know, China really has made a name for itself in the wine opener game, dominating the global market with a hefty 30% share. But, man, it's not all smooth sailing over there. They've got a lot of hurdles to jump through, mostly because of geopolitical stuff and trade policies that seem to change on a whim. A big concern right now is the looming threat of tariffs from the U.S. government, and we're talking potentially hitting a whopping 50% on imports. That sort of situation can really scare off international buyers, which makes things pretty tough for China as they try to broaden their reach in the wine opener market around the world.

On the flip side, the European Union is stepping up to the plate with a commission that's set up to tackle the issues plaguing the wine industry. This is pretty relevant, even for accessory makers like those producing wine openers. The goal is to open up conversation and develop solid strategies that can help everyone in the wine world work better together. By pinpointing the challenges and working on solutions—like negotiating trade agreements and lessening the impacts of tariffs—they can create a path for both China and the EU to keep growing in this ever-changing marketplace.
